It works with Windows 10 and older versions of Windows, as well as Linux via the command line. Since it's published by the Free Software Foundation, you can freely share the program with others under the terms of the GNU Lesser General Public License.
7-Zip creates archives with the 7Z file extension. It's easy to use, works with Windows Shell, supports encryption, and is completely free for both personal and commercial use. While Windows does include its own built-in compression tool, its functions are limited.

Windows can only read and create ZIP files, and you can't repair damaged archives. Security is also an issue with Windows.
If you use the Windows compression tool, you won't be able to encrypt the file. In fact, it will decrypt a formerly encrypted file. Ukrainian freelance programmer Igor Pavlov owns the 7-Zip Copyright (C) and released the beta version in January 1999.

7-Zip Features
Here are some other features worth mentioning: Integrates with the Windows Explorer context menuAssociate the program with any file extension of your choosing to make opening files easierSupports encryption when creating new archivesCan build self-extracting executable archivesCan calculate checksums from the context menuFor ZIP and GZIP formats, 7-Zip provides a compression ratio that is 2-10 percent better than the ratio provided by PKZip and WinZipStrong AES-256 encryption in 7z and ZIP formatsSelf-extracting capability for 7z formatSupports dozens of languages
Compatible Formats
These are the file extensions 7-Zip can open, followed by the ones that it supports creating:
Extract From
001 (002, etc.), 7Z, ARJ, BZ2, BZIP2, CAB, CHM, CHW, CPIO, CRAMFS, DEB, DMG, DOC, EXE, FAT, GZ, GZIP, HFS, HXS, ISO, LHA, LZH, LZMA, MBR, MSI, NTFS, PPT, QCOW2, RAR, RPM, SQUASHFS, SWM, TAR, TAZ, TBZ, TBZ2, TGZ, VDI, VDMK, VHD, WIM, XAR, XLS, XZ, Z01 (Z02, etc.), Z, ZIP, ZIPX
Compress To
7Z, TAR, WIM, ZIP
Security Options
Can password-protect 7Z and ZIP archive formats with 256-bit AES encryption. 7-Zip Review
7-Zip is one of the easiest decompression software programs to use for both unzipping and creating archives, even if it doesn't support the vast number of unpacking formats like PeaZip.

Other decompression programs support file unzipping, but because 7-Zip is installed closely with Windows Shell, right-clicking to extract an archive is very straight forward. The program includes a built-in file browser that can locate or extract archives. You can also test an archive.
7-Zip adheres to most Windows Explorer standards except that, unlike Windows, 7-Zip displays hidden files. Since the file browser is basically the same as File/Windows Explorer, you can also choose to use the Windows Shell integration to create and extract archive files rather than having to open the full program.
